Job description

Clinical Application Specialist (CAS) is a clinical education role focused on internal and external clinical and educational support. This role also supports broader company revenue growth goals via customer support and education. The CAS position will be responsible for providing training and education to new and existing Sentec users and will work closely with the field sales and marketing organization to support new hire and ongoing sales training and development. Expectations of the role include on-site and virtual education, training and CE and non-CE Presentations, and in-person state and potential national society presentations.

Key Tasks

  • Acts as the subject matter expert for the use of our products in our key market segments to support company revenue growth goals.
  • Collaborates with the local sales team to coordinate and deliver comprehensive onsite and virtual customer training and education i.e., curriculum, process/tools and programs.
  • Develops a common understanding of the technology across care providers and articulates the clinical & economic value proposition.
  • Participates in product evaluations and installations.
  • Assesses needs and ensures comprehensive education and hands-on training on our products, including maintenance and troubleshooting that addresses all members of the clinical team.
  • Provides education and training necessary to drive optimal bedside use of the technology in new and existing accounts.
  • This is a remote position (home-based in the southern CA or Phoenix, AZ region) with the ability to travel overnight (60%+) and work flexible hours.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Science or equivalent education and/or experience.
  • Current RRT or RN license is required.
  • Prior experience training/educating healthcare professionals is preferred.
  • Prior experience in the Medical Device Industry in a Clinical Specialist role is highly preferred.
  • Existing In-depth knowledge and usage of Sentec products preferred.
  • Ability to quickly understand new product enhancements and training programs/materials.
  • Must be vaccinated for Covid-19 and must obtain any/all required vaccinations as appropriate for vendor credentialing

Sentec is a Swiss-American medical device company specializing in respiratory care. Since its founding in 1999, Sentec utilizes a deep-tech approach that is founded on advanced science and avant-garde technologies for respiratory patients across care areas. Sentec provides healthcare professionals worldwide with non-invasive, continuous monitoring and effective therapeutic solutions.
